1.1 --- a/doc/tazpanel.html Mon Apr 11 19:51:47 2011 +0200 1.2 +++ b/doc/tazpanel.html Sun Sep 27 16:12:27 2020 +0000 1.3 @@ -1,1 +1,84 @@ 1.4 -tazpanel.en.html 1.5 \ No newline at end of file 1.6 +<div id="help"> 1.7 + 1.8 + <section> 1.9 + <header>English Help</header> 1.10 + <div> 1.11 + 1.12 + <p> 1.13 + TazPanel is the SliTaz administration and settings center from where 1.14 + you can control your entire system such as managing packages, adding 1.15 + or removing users, creating Live systems and much more. Navigation 1.16 + is done with the toolbar at the top of the application window and 1.17 + in some cases with a submenu or a side bar as in the packages interface. 1.18 + </p> 1.19 + 1.20 + <p> 1.21 + In most cases you will get a description and useful information with 1.22 + the section concerned. TazPanel uses the latest HTMLÂ 5 and CSSÂ 3 technology 1.23 + to provide a clean and easy to use frontend for all the administration tasks 1.24 + that you can do on SliTaz. TazPanel has also been coded from the beginning 1.25 + with speed and quality in mind and it also supports full 1.26 + internationalization. 1.27 + </p> 1.28 + 1.29 + <p> 1.30 + TazPanel is run as a web server on port 82 by default and can be used only 1.31 + from the local system. If you wish to control your system from a remote host 1.32 + you can change the server configuration file to allow connections from a 1.33 + local network or the entire world wide web, but in this last case make sure 1.34 + that you set a strong password for the panel. The server configuration file is 1.35 + <a data-icon="@text@" href="index.cgi?file=/etc/slitaz/httpd.conf">/etc/slitaz/httpd.conf</a>. 1.36 + </p> 1.37 + 1.38 + 1.39 + <h3>Terminal</h3> 1.40 + 1.41 + <p> 1.42 + TazPanel provides a small terminal emulator which lets you execute commands as 1.43 + root on the remote or local system. Not all available commands are usable 1.44 + and you should use a SSH connection for most tasks. That said, having access 1.45 + to a few commands within the web interface can be useful and <tt>wget</tt> is 1.46 + supported to allow file uploads on a remote machine. The download directory 1.47 + is <tt>/var/www/downloads</tt> by default. All commands can use options such as 1.48 + <tt>-R</tt> <tt>-l</tt> etc. 1.49 + </p> 1.50 + 1.51 + 1.52 + <h3>Get Support</h3> 1.53 + 1.54 + <p> 1.55 + You can get support on the SliTaz <a data-icon="@web@" href="http://forum.slitaz.org/" target="_blank" rel="noopener" rel="noopener">forum</a>, 1.56 + the <a data-icon="@web@" href="http://www.slitaz.org/en/mailing-list.php" 1.57 + target="_blank" rel="noopener" rel="noopener">mailing list</a> or the <a data-icon="@web@" href="http://irc.slitaz.org/" 1.58 + target="_blank" rel="noopener" rel="noopener">IRC channel</a>.
